
Toyota 3.0L V6 3VZE / 3VZ-FE Specs, Problems, Review
The early version of this engine 3VZ-E has SOHC aluminum cylinder heads and original pistons. The compression ratio of these engines is only 9.0:1. The redeveloped version and more performance engine the 3VZ-FE was produced from 1992 to 1997. The 3VZ-FE got aluminum DOHC heads with the increased diameter of the intake valves to 34 mm from 33 mm.
Toyota VZ engine - Wikipedia
The Toyota VZ engine family is a series of V6 gasoline piston engines ranging from 2.0 to 3.4 L (1,992 to 3,378 cc) in displacement and both SOHC and DOHC configurations. [1] It was Toyota's first V6 engine, being made as a response to Nissan’s VG engine, one of Japan's first mass-produced V6 engines.

Is The Toyota 3.0 V6 A Good Motor - GearShifters
A modified 3VZ-E iron-block engine coupled with aluminum DOHC 24 valve heads forms the basis of the design. It has cast connecting rods and a crankshaft made of forged steel. Three sets of runners for both heads are fed by Toyota’s ACIS variable-intake system through a split-chamber upper intake plenum.
Toyota 3VZ-FE Engine | Tuning, specs, firing order, oil etc
2016年7月9日 · In 1992, the production of a more modern 3VZ-FE engine has started. The differences between 3VZ-E and 3VZ-FE are the new DOHC heads with two camshafts for each. Differences between 3VZ-FE and its precursor 2VZ-FE are the following: a new forged crankshaft with 82 mm stroke, new pistons, the compression ratio of 9.6.

The Toyota VZ Series - Olathe Toyota Parts Center
The low-angle DOHC cylinder heads on the VZ Series were designed by Yamaha Motor to give excellent low- and mid-range torque. The series uses cast iron engine blocks, forged steel crankshafts, and in the third-generation, cast iron main bearing support girdles.
Toyota 3VZ-FE Engine: Specifications and technical data
The 3VZ-FE features a cast-iron cylinder block with a four-bearings crankshaft and two aluminum heads with two camshafts (DOHC) and four valves per cylinder (24 in total). The engine is equipped with SFI (Sequential Multiport Fuel Injection) system and an electronic ignition system with a mechanical distributor.
